Seven Acres of Marijuana Farms Destroyed
9 Suspects Rounded up

By Ishmael F. Menkor, Our Nimba County Correspondent
Published:  23 May, 2008

NIMBA COUNTY, On a joint operation to crack down on the production and trafficking of narcotic drugs, security forces in Nimba, headed by the Drugs Enforcement Agency (DEA), LNP, in collaboration with UNPOL and backed by FPU and the UNMIL Bangladeshi forces, raided two marijuana farms in the Sokopa area between Nimba and Bong counties.
